Arkansas Governor’s School Applications

Applications are being taken for the 42nd Arkansas Governor’s School, set for July 5-31 and hosted by Arkansas Tech University in Russellville. Eligible students need to inquire about the nomination process with their school counselor. AGS serves approximately 400 selected students from around the state during the summer before their senior year in high school. Information and instructions for applying are available at www.atu.edu/ags, and the deadline to apply is Jan. 20. For more information, email ags@atu.edu or call (479) 968-0391.

Single Parent Scholarship Fund Application Deadline

SEARCY — The deadline for applying for White County Single Parent Scholarship Fund Inc. spring 2021 scholarships is Jan. 7. The fund awards scholarships to White County residents who are single parents of minor children and are pursuing postsecondary education in order to achieve skilled employment. View the application and instructions at www.aspsf.org. For more information, contact Executive Director Dan Newsom at wcspsf.inc@gmail.com or (501) 230-2414.
